I have recently bought a 2 year old Civic I want to change the factory head unit, but i have been told it can effect the keyless entry system as the head unit recieves the signal. is this right??

on the 96-98 i know for sure the keyless entry goes through the head unit.

i am not sure about anything newer but i don think so.

There is a special thing made...a T connector. It will allow you to hook up your AM headunit (in dash) and hide the stock headunit behind the dash with both connected.

This will allow you to have a new headunit and keep your keyless entry.

Aside from that, I would recommend you get a good alarm (which usually come with AM keyless entry) when you replace your radio anyway. Safety.
